#[derive(Debug)]
pub struct QueryExtN<T>(pub T)
where
T: for<'a> Deserialize<'a>;
impl<'a, T> FromRequest<'a> for QueryExtN<T>
where
T: for<'b> Deserialize<'b>,
{
async fn from_request(req: &'a poem::Request, _: &mut poem::RequestBody) -> Result<Self> {
let query = req.uri().query().unwrap_or_default();
let decode_query = match decode(query) {
Ok(query) => query.into_owned(),
Err(err) => {
return Err(Error::from_string(
format!("decode query string error:{}", err),
StatusCode::INTERNAL_SERVER_ERROR,
));
}
};
let object = serde_qs::from_str::<T>(&decode_query);
match object {
Ok(object) => {
return Ok(Self(object));
}
Err(err) => {
return Err(Error::from_string(
format!("parse query string to object error:{}", err),
StatusCode::INTERNAL_SERVER_ERROR,
));
}
}
}
}
